Senator Kimberley Kitching

Prime Minister

The death of Senator Kimberley Kitching, at just 52, is a deep and terrible shock.

Senator Kitching was a serious parliamentarian who had a deep interest in Australia’s national security.

She had a passion about Australia’s national interest and argued for it.

She demonstrated that her passion for her country was always greater than any partisan view. She clearly loved her country and it genuinely showed.

I came to greatly respect the way Senator Kitching approached the issues.

Senator Kitching was a practicing Catholic and we witnessed her authentic faith in the life of the Parliament. She followed her conscience and was fearless and I admired that.

She was respected by those on both sides of the Parliament – she was a parliamentarian in the truest sense. Senator Kitching was deeply respected by the Coalition.

To Senator Kitching’s family I extend the sympathies of the Government.
